fre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

銀行atm系統(tǒng)軟件工程—基于uml的設(shè)計與實現(xiàn)畢業(yè)論文(完整版)

2025-07-25 05:28上一頁面

下一頁面
  

【正文】 開發(fā)期限:7周。 可驗證性:軟件系統(tǒng)應(yīng)易于檢查、測試和評審 引用文件 引用文檔 《軟件工程術(shù)語》 (GB/T 11457-1995) ――中華人民共和國國家標準 19951201 實施 參考文件 1.《UML與Rational Rose從入門到精通》….....Wendy Boggs等著 《Visual C++動感設(shè)計》——飛思科技,電子工業(yè)出版社,2002年9月 《Visual C++入門與提高》——清華大學(xué)出版社,2002年6月 《Visual C++、MFC導(dǎo)學(xué)》——人民郵電出版社,2xxx年1月 《Visual C++編程高手》——機械工業(yè)出版社,2001年12月 任務(wù)概述本項軟件是為了實現(xiàn)對銀行ATM系統(tǒng)的模擬。軟件工程文檔銀行ATM系統(tǒng)—基于UML的設(shè)計與實現(xiàn)目 錄引言 4 編寫目的 4 讀者對象 4 軟件項目概述 4 文檔概述 4 定義 5 引用文件 5引用文檔 5參考文件 5任務(wù)概述 6 6 6 用戶特征 6 假設(shè)與約束 61.2 初步需求分析 8分析問題域 83.1 Actor(參與者) 83.2 Use case(用例) 93.3 Use Case Diagram(系統(tǒng)用例圖) 94.靜態(tài)結(jié)構(gòu)模型 104.2 CRC 11邊界類: 11實體類: 13控制類: 14其他類: 165.動態(tài)行為模型 185.1事件流描述 185.2 順序圖 216. 界面設(shè)計要求 30軟件測試方案 38四、功能測試 39 子功能1—插卡 39 子功能2—登錄 39 子功能3—選擇賬戶 39 子功能4—選擇操作 39五、用例測試 40 用例1—存款 40 用例2—取款 40 用例3—轉(zhuǎn)賬 40 用例4—查詢余額 40 用例5—更改密碼 407.工程進度總覽 41工程進度總覽 38 引言 編寫目的按照面向?qū)ο筌浖こ趟枷?,為便于銀行ATM系統(tǒng)軟件開發(fā),為其提供可靠的文檔資料,增強此軟件的可讀性與可維護性,記錄整個軟件開發(fā)過程。 有效性:充分利用計算機的時間和空間資源。 假設(shè)與約束 假設(shè)經(jīng)費限制:此軟件為課程設(shè)計作業(yè),無經(jīng)費限制。 ATM系統(tǒng)必須向客戶提供如下服務(wù): 客戶可以做一次取款(取款金額必須是100元人民幣的整數(shù)倍),在現(xiàn)金被提取之前,必須得到銀行的許可。 如果客戶不能在五次嘗試之后成功地進入PIN,客戶的卡將被機器沒收,而客戶不得不聯(lián)系銀行取回它。進行驗證客戶密碼的登錄功能。 (6)QueryAccount(查詢余額) 提供查詢余額的功能。 A. 系統(tǒng)提示客戶輸入密碼。 ⑷事件流 ⅰ.主事件流 客戶向系統(tǒng)輸入存款金額并向機器輸入現(xiàn)金時,用例啟動。否則,系統(tǒng)狀態(tài)不變。 ⑵前提條件 在本用例開始前,客戶必須已經(jīng)登錄到系統(tǒng)中。 。STATE_RETAIN_CARD 由于密碼輸入錯誤,您的磁卡已被沒收, 請持您的有效證件于銀行內(nèi)部領(lǐng)取磁卡 用戶輸入正確的密碼后,則可以登陸進入賬戶選擇界面。STATE_DEPOSIT_PUT_CASH 請放入您的存款 返回ii. 確定后,進入確認界面。STATE_TRANSFER_CHOOSE_ACCOUNT 請選擇您所要轉(zhuǎn)賬的目的賬戶: *賬戶序號 賬戶名 賬號 余額1 〈賬戶名〉 〈賬號〉 余額2 〈賬戶名〉 〈賬號〉 余額3 〈賬戶名〉 〈賬號〉 余額4 〈賬戶名〉 〈賬號〉 余額取回磁卡 返回ii. 系統(tǒng)將進入轉(zhuǎn)移賬戶界面。 點擊“確定”按鈕,如果顯示登錄界面則正確。 五、用例測試 用例1—存款鼠標點擊“存款” 按鈕。 如果顯示操作成功則正確。婁國哲、曾坤參加數(shù)模競賽全體工程人員第二次會議,布置任務(wù):分析問題域,識別Actor和UseCase,設(shè)計用例圖。婁國哲、苑魯峰、司宏偉分別編碼。全體工程人員第三次會議,統(tǒng)一進一步建模思想。 用例5—更改密碼鼠標點擊“更改密碼” 按鈕。 輸入100元倍數(shù),“確定”。 如果顯示選擇操作界面則正確。STATE_FAILED 操作失敗軟件測試方案一、 測試思想:二、測試規(guī)范:三、測試目的:可以正常插卡、登錄、選擇賬戶、選擇操作、。STATE_CHANGE_PIN_INPUT_NEW_PIN 請輸入您的新密碼: ***********取回磁卡 返回ii. 進入確認新密碼界面。STATE_WITHDRAW_INPUT_CASH 請輸入您的取款金額(本機只提供只提供100元的鈔票): 5000 取回磁卡 返回ii. 確定后,進入下一界面。STATE_WELCOME *****銀行Wele ….. 請插入磁卡 當用戶插入磁卡時,屏幕顯示“要求輸入密碼”界面。 。 ,并更新賬戶的相關(guān)信息。 ⅱ.替代流 E1: 若賬戶不存在或無效,系統(tǒng)顯示信息,客戶可以重新輸入或終止用例。 ② Deposit(存款) ⑴簡要說明 本用例描述了客戶如何存款到機器中。 ⑵前提條件 無。根據(jù)Task(存款、取款,轉(zhuǎn)帳,查詢,更改密碼)的事件流描述給出具體的處理。 示例:銀行的工作人員。 客戶通過有效驗證后可以更改密碼。 1.2 初步需求獲取 此軟件的設(shè)計將實現(xiàn)銀行ATM系統(tǒng)的基本功能。 開發(fā):此軟件代碼由Visual C++,由MFC工具開發(fā)。 軟件項目概述l 項目名稱:工商銀行ATM系統(tǒng) l 簡稱:銀行ATM系統(tǒng) l 項目代號:國標90010603 l 軟件項目的大致功能:銀行客戶存款、取款、轉(zhuǎn)賬、查詢余額、更改密碼。 文檔概述本文檔的大致內(nèi)容為: l 軟件的編寫目的 l 軟件的功能、性能描述 l 軟件的開發(fā)過程描述 l 軟件的界面設(shè)計 l 軟件的測試與維護 定義文檔: 記錄軟件開發(fā)活動和階段性成果,為理解軟件所必需的闡述性資料 數(shù)據(jù)
點擊復(fù)制文檔內(nèi)容
范文總結(jié)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1